English: View looking downriver at the Missiguash during low tide. The river forms part of the boundary between New Brunswick and Nova Scotia, Canada. In the photo, Nova Scotia is on left side of the river and New Brunswick on the right. In the background is the National Historic Site of Tonges Island, former home of the Seigneur Michel de la Valliere who in 1676 had a manor house there. The island may be identified by the copse of trees. A modern home exists there now.
